ianward 0 Posted August 18, 2011 This has the potential to be a good photograph, but there are a few things that you need to bear in mind. What is the main interest? In this case the gorgeous little girl. The background adds nothing to the picture so it should be blurred out. Select a large appeture like F4, this will focus on the little girl and give a nice out of focus background.The balance of the photo is really important, we generally conform to the thirds rule. Here you have one third of the main subject and two thirds of nothing, suggesting quite a wide angle lens was used. Nothing wrong with this but she needs to be a bit more prominent. NOT in the center of the frame but to one side as you have here is best. You could crop some of the top off too.The skin tones are good and not blown out but it does lack a bit of contrast. She has lovely big brown eyes that will be a good thing to focus in on when you get in close. Link to comment
